互联网向IPv6迈进 2000-12-18 00:00:00·
胡西·yesky
上一页 1 2 3 下一页
IPv6的主要特点
IPv6保持了IPv4的大多数概念,如IPv6还支持无连接的传递,允许发送方选择数据报的大小,要求发送方指明数据报在到达终点前的最大跳数,以及大部分选项等。但IPv6改变了协议的许多细节,如使用更大的地址空间,尤其是IPv6修订了IPv4的数据报格式,用一系列固定格式的首部取代了IPv4中可变长度的选项字段。IPv6数据包头的主要特性如下:
1、无限的地址空间
IPv6的地址域是128bit的,可能的地址数是2128个。如同IPv4一样,IPv6把一个地址与一个特定的网络连接关联,一个IPv6路由器有多个地址,而具有一个网络连接的主机只需一个地址。为了地址分配和修改的方便,IPv6允许给一个给定的网络指派多个前缀,也允许对一个主机的给定接口同时指派多个地址。IPv6还扩充或者说统一了IPv4的特殊地址。一个报文的目的地址可归为以下三类。
Unicast单播:目的地址指明一个单一的计算机,数据报将选择一条最短的路径到达目的站。
Cluster群播:目的站是共享一个地址前缀的计算机的集合,数据报将选择一条最短的路径到达该组,然后只投递给组中的一个成员。
Multicast多播:目的站是一组计算机,数据报将通过硬件组播或广播投递给每一个成员。
2、头部的简化和可扩展性
IPv6的另一个主要进步就是对包头的简化,尽量避免那些很少使用的域静态地占用空间。它仅包含7个字段(IPv4有13个)。这使路由器处理分组的速度加快,提高了吞吐率。
IPv6数据包头中的“NextHeader”域,它指向数据包头的扩展部分,这样便可以在如此简单的结构里提供很多可选的特征。同IPv4一样,IPv6允许数据报包含可选的控制信息,但在IPv4头中必需的字段现在只是IPv6的选项。而且,选项出现在扩展头部中,使路由器可以简单的跳过选项,加速了分组处理的过程。另外还包含了IPv4所不具备的选项,可以提供新的设施。
3、安全性的提高
IPv6利用数据包头的扩展部分可以提供路由器级的安全性。IPv6中强制性的安全性包括两方面的内容。一方面,IPv6数据包的接收者可以要求发送者首先利用IPv6认证头(数据包头的扩展部分)进行“登录”,然后才接收数据包,这种登录是算法独立的,可以有效地阻止网络“黑客”的攻击。另一方面,利用IPv6的封闭安全头(数据包头的扩展部分)加密数据包,这种加密也是算法独立的,这意味着可以安全地在Internet上传输敏感数据,不用担心被第三方截取。
4、高性能和高QoS
加长的“Payload Length”使IPv6的数据包可以远远超过64k字节,应用程序可以利用最大传输单元(MTU)特征获得更快、更可靠的数据传输。
“Flow labels”域极大地改善了IPv6的服务质量。一个“流”是从一个源节点发送的多个数据包。“Flow labels”域允许源节点排列流各数据包的逻辑顺序,路由器便可以维护此流的前后关系,这样便有可能优化传输性能和拥塞管理。
上一页 1 2 3 下一页 |